The Bingel-Hirsch reaction between fullerene C-60, and 2-methacryloyloxyethyl methyl malonate or 2-methacryloyloxyethyl dichloroacetate afforded the corresponding monocyclopropanation products.

The present invention relates to a continuous method of preparing a block-graft or star-shaped copolymer. This method involves providing a living polymer, mixing the living polymer with a first monomer under conditions effective to produce a block copolymer, wherein the first monomer includes a polymerization site and a polymerization initiation site, and mixing the block copolymer with a second monomer under conditions effective to produce a block-graft or star-shaped copolymer. The present invention also relates to a continuous method of preparing a graft or graft-block copolymer. This method involves mixing a first monomer and a second monomer under conditions effective to produce a copolymer of the first and second monomers, wherein the second monomer comprises a polymerization site and a polymerization initiation site, mixing the copolymer with a third monomer under conditions effective to produce a graft copolymer, and mixing the graft copolymer with a fourth monomer under conditions effective to produce a graft-block copolymer. The present invention also relates to graft, graft-block, block-graft, and star-shaped copolymers produced by the methods of the present invention.
